修正画布 Agent 图片编辑素材类型

新 Agent 图片编辑任务以空 assetKind 表示普通静态图片。

仅为可信历史 Agent 队列任务归一旧 synthetic 素材类型。

兼容已持久化旧 Agent 图片资源并保持普通请求失败关闭。

补充 Agent payload 到 worker 门禁及历史兼容回归测试。

- 背景:画布生成结果统一显示快速编辑,但部分角色动作 / 序列帧和音频结果会进入不受支持的图片编辑链路;不同入口各自判断时也容易继续漂移。
- 决策:快速编辑只支持普通静态图片、角色图、规范图、完整图标图集、UI 设计图、宣发图和视频。单个拆分图标、角色动作 / 序列帧、音效与背景音乐不支持;新增媒体或素材类型默认不开放。浮动工具栏、图层右键菜单、独立图片菜单、打开面板入口和提交门禁统一调用同一个正向白名单;后端图片编辑 BFF 基于目标图层的有效素材类型与媒体类型执行同一正向门禁,视频快速编辑只走视频生成接口。
- 边界:角色动作继续通过对应的动作生成链路处理,不再把当前帧当作可快速编辑图片。
- 2026-08-06 修订:画布 Agent 的 `edit_image` 只接受图片输入,新任务以 `assetKind=null` 表示普通静态图片,不再使用 synthetic `editor_agent_edit_image`。worker 仅按服务端生成的 `editor-agent:` dedupe namespace 识别并归一历史排队 payload;普通调用伪造旧值继续被拒绝。已持久化资源中的旧值只有在后端从真实目标图层 / 项目资源解析后才兼容为空类型,避免历史 Agent 结果失去快速编辑能力,同时不扩大请求白名单。
- 验证:模型测试覆盖允许与拒绝类型,工具栏和两类右键菜单测试覆盖单个拆分图标、角色动作及音频不展示,提交工作流测试覆盖单个拆分图标和角色动作绕过入口时仍拒绝;后端表驱动测试覆盖全部现役素材 / 媒体类型与未知类型,锁定图片编辑端点失败关闭。
